mod 97 value??
I have an OLD mod 97. S/N traces it to 1907. 100 years old. It had been used a on the farm from where I got it. 26" cyl choke barrel, blueing worn, Stock cut down. I built it up and put a leather lace up pad on it. They cut the stock down so the kids and the lady fok could use it. They always kept the darn thing for for any 4 legged or 2 legged trouble came by. Can anyone suggest what it might be worth. Irt old but quite servicable, I have used it for grouse hunting and have checked it out for slug shooting, it does quite good.

Strut64
I assume you are refering to Winchester Model 97 Slide Action with visible hammer. Without seeing and by your description it should be worth approximately $300.00 to $400.00 USD. jplonghunter |
